  1. C. P. Krishnan Nair. Captain Chittarath Poovakkatt Krishnan Nair (9 February 1922 – 17 May 2014) was an Indian businessman who founded The Leela Group. [2] [3] [4] He was a 2010 recipient of the Padma Bhushan, given by Government of India. [5] He was sometimes popularly known as Captain Nair due to his service in the Indian Army .
